Finland's melodic doom/death metal duo The Bleak Picture prepares to unveil its sophomore full-length, Shades Of Life. The album will see the light of day on 27 June through Ardua Music on CD and digitally, while the first single/video, "Without The I", is already out.
Vocalist Tero Ruohonen (Autumnfall, Temple Of Kliffoth) and multi-instrumentalist Jussi Hänninen (Autumnfall, ex-Fall Of The Leafe) have been working together under the banner of The Bleak Picture since 2021. They released their first EP, Songs Of Longing, that same year, and then in 2024, unveiled their debut full-length, Meaningless. In 2025, Ruohonen and Hänninen are ready to present the second album from The Bleak Picture, and the strides taken since that well-received debut are remarkable.
